Dear Customer,
Thank you for getting in touch and raising an important issue regarding
sourcing in Indonesia.
We take all of these matters very seriously and have been engaging with
Friends of the Earth and the broader electronics industry on this issue for
some time. We are also undertaking a thorough investigation of our supply
chain in the region to better understand what is happening, and what part we
play. While we do not have a direct relationship with tin suppliers from
Bangka Island, we do know that some of the tin that we use for manufacturing
our products does originate from this area, which sources much of the
electronics industry.
We believe that our work on this issue should be collaborative, and as a
responsible business we are contacting suppliers, industry bodies and
governments to better understand the issues that you raise and work together
to find solutions. We will communicate with you again as we learn more about
this matter.

Philips accepts recycling responsibility
They campaigned and it worked. Note that activism can achieve things: VICTORY! Philips accepts recycling responsibility | Greenpeace International: "Philips had been the biggest obstacle in the electronics industry to tackling the growing problem of e-waste. And we have been calling on them since 2007 to stop actively opposing laws that would oblige electronics producers to accept financial responsibility for the recycling of their own products.
After several actions and 47,000 messages from our supporters, the company has finally agreed to our demands. This is a big step forward, and makes Philips a new green leader in the electronics sector."
It's important that these things happen at the level of the producers; too many things devolved to consumers will not happen widely enough because of laziness and cussed contrariness. If we do it right in the first place we won't need to clear up the mess!

Final negotiations are underway right now in Dublin, Ireland on a treaty to ban cluster bombs -- but its outcome is in danger.
Cluster munitions don't just kill during war--they scatter small, unexploded "bomblets" on the ground. When children pick them up, they are often maimed or killed. Most governments agree that they should be banned--but many are now trying to weaken the proposed treaty with loopholes, exemptions, and delays.
